Quaternium-15, Use Test

An Open Single Centre Evaluation of the Reactivity of the T.R.U.E. Test Quaternium-15 Patch and a Real Use Exposure in Subjects Known to Be Allergic to Quaternium-15

Conditions

Allergic Contact Dermatitis Towards Quaternium-15

Brief summary

The study is required by the FDA as part of a post-marketing commitment. The purpose of the study is to compare the reactivity of the TRUE Test quaternium-15 patch and a real use exposure.The subjects will wear the patch test for 48 hours and reading will be performed day 3 or 4. The use test will be applied from day 3 or 4 and untill reaction appears. Reactions from respectively TRUE Test and use test will be compared using the McNemar Change Test.

Inclusion criteria

* Sensitivity to quaternium-15 * Age more than 18 years

Exclusion criteria

* Topical or systemic treatment with corticosteroids or immunosuppresives. * Treatment with UV-light * Widespread active dermatitis or dermatitis on test area
